Most hospital CNA positions in Florida require a current Florida CNA license and Basic Life Support (BLS) certification. Hospitals typically offer a variety of schedules, including day, night, weekend, per diem, and part-time roles. Large healthcare systems such as AdventHealth, Lee Health, and Tenet Healthcare frequently post openings due to ongoing staffing needs.
Healthcare staffing agencies can also help place CNAs quickly in hospital or clinical settings, sometimes offering higher pay, flexible schedules, or short-term contract opportunities.
If you’re looking for hospital CNA positions in Florida, there are several effective ways to apply. Job boards like Indeed allow you to search for hospital CNA openings in your city or surrounding areas. Many hospitals also list open positions directly on their websites under “Careers” or “Employment Opportunities.” Additionally, healthcare staffing platforms often advertise contract or travel CNA roles within hospital systems.
To work as a CNA in a Florida hospital, an active Florida CNA license is required.
